Pārlūkot izejas kodu

已修改 src/views/pro/traceability/components/collectionCom.vue

qinhb 3 mēneši atpakaļ
vecāks
revīzija
7a19547a75

+ 20 - 5
src/views/pro-steps/components/screwdriver.vue

@@ -25,14 +25,13 @@
             >新增数据</span
           >
 
-
           <el-select
             v-model="taskId"
             v-if="item.deviceType == 'DDLSD'"
             placeholder="选择任务号"
             size="large"
             @click.stop=""
-            style="position: absolute; right: 180px; z-index: 2; width: 140px"
+            style="position: absolute; right: 300px; z-index: 2; width: 140px"
           >
             <el-option
               v-for="item in options2"
@@ -41,6 +40,16 @@
               :value="item.value"
             />
           </el-select>
+
+          <el-button
+              class="ces"
+              type="primary"
+              style="position: absolute; right: 180px; z-index: 2"
+              v-if="item.deviceType == 'DDLSD'"
+              @click.stop="setTipTemperature"
+              :disabled="tipTemperatureDisabled"
+          >设置程序</el-button
+          >
           <!-- DDLSD -->
           <!-- WKDLT -->
 
@@ -185,7 +194,7 @@ const tipTemperatureDisabled = ref(false);
 const setTipTemperature = async () => {
   try {
     tipTemperatureDisabled.value = true;
-    const { code } = await setUpData1({ tipTemperature: tipTemperature.value });
+    const { code } = await setUpData1({ taskId: taskId.value });
     if (code == "200") {
       ElMessage.success("设置成功!");
     }
@@ -313,8 +322,12 @@ const showLable = (key) => {
       return "持续时间";
     case "DataTimes":
       return "采集时间";
-    case "result":
+    case "tighteningresult":
       return "拧紧结果";
+    case "ng":
+      return "NG";
+    case "alarm":
+      return "警报";
     case "error":
       return "警报";
     case "length":
@@ -406,7 +419,9 @@ const configeObj = (type) => {
         "torque",
         "angle",
         "duration",
-        "result",
+        "tighteningresult",
+        "ng",
+        "alarm"
       ];
     default:
       return ["数据1", "数据2", "数据3"];

+ 8 - 2
src/views/traceability/components/collect.vue

@@ -96,7 +96,9 @@ const configeObj = (type) => {
         "torque",
         "angle",
         "duration",
-        "result",
+        "tighteningresult",
+          "ng",
+          "alarm"
       ];
     default:
       return ["数据1", "数据2", "数据3"];
@@ -116,8 +118,12 @@ const showLable = (key) => {
       return "持续时间";
     case "DataTimes":
       return "采集时间";
-    case "result":
+    case "tighteningresult":
       return "拧紧结果";
+    case "ng":
+      return "NG";
+    case "alarm":
+      return "警报";
     case "error":
       return "警报";
     case "length":